**Handover: GratiMail receipt sender**

Passing GratiMail from me to Orla. It sends donation receipts for the Fernbrook giving platform within five minutes of a confirmed payment. Common support issues: duplicate receipts (check the dedupe window) and missing tax-year summaries (rerun the batch job). Retries are automatic, three attempts. The production sender runs with these configuration values.

settings of yahaf-tahop:
jorox:
  pin: 5851
  tenant: noveth
  seal: seal_7ddb5c42
  metrics_host: metrics.jorox.ordinnet.example
  standby_team: wenax
  escalation: oliath-feneth
  nonce: 552548

## TilePrime Prefetcher — Who to Contact

TilePrime prefetches map tiles ahead of viewport pans. Owned by the Cartogrid team. Config lives in the prefetcher repo; deploys go through the standard Cartogrid pipeline. For cache-hit regressions, ping the team channel first. Capacity or quota changes require sign-off from the Cartogrid lead, Marit Oselund. For anything urgent outside business hours, reach the on-call rotation directly at the address below.

escalation mailbox, hadug-bajog: sormir@norvalabs.internal

# Proctoring queue constants for the Vigilum exam platform.
# Support: if candidates report long waits at Bramfield Academy peaks,
# check queue depth before escalating. Timeouts here govern how long
# a session holds a proctor slot before recycling. Do not edit in prod
# without sign-off. The current values are defined directly below.

tuning table, fawip-fahag:
WEIGHTS = {
    "novwyn": 452,
    "casdor": 675,
}

## Support

RateVault caches jurisdiction tax rates with a 24-hour TTL. Stale rates almost always mean the upstream feed lagged — check the feed timestamp before blaming the cache. Cache invalidation is manual only; see `ops/flush.md`. Do not extend the TTL without a written approval note in the repo. Questions about ownership or feed contracts should go to the RateVault maintainers.

billing contact of hahig-yajop = fraael_fraox@nelvrocorp.internal